الانتقال إلى المحتوى الرئيسي
POST
/
workflows
/
runs
/
{runId}
/
rerun
إعادة تشغيل مسار عمل
curl --request POST \
  --url https://api.altostrat.io/workflows/runs/{runId}/rerun \
  --header 'Authorization: Bearer <token>'
{
  "message": "تم بدء إعادة تشغيل مسار العمل بنجاح.",
  "new_run": {
    "id": "fl_run_01h3j4k5l6m7n8p9q0r1s2t3u4",
    "status": "completed",
    "error_message": "فشل طلب webhook: 503 الخدمة غير متوفرة",
    "started_at": "2025-10-31T12:00:00.000000Z",
    "completed_at": "2025-10-31T12:00:05.000000Z",
    "duration_in_seconds": 5,
    "logs": [
      {
        "id": "fl_log_01h3j4k5l6m7n8p9q0r1s2t3u4",
        "node_id": "n2",
        "component_id": "webhook",
        "status": "success",
        "output": {
          "status": 200,
          "body": {
            "message": "ok"
          }
        },
        "created_at": "2025-10-31T12:00:02.000000Z"
      }
    ]
  }
}

Authorizations

Authorization
string
header
required

رمز JWT قياسي لجلسات المستخدم التي يتم الحصول عليها عبر مصادقة Altostrat.

Path Parameters

runId
string
required

المعرف المسبوق بالبادئة لعملية تشغيل مسار العمل (مثال fl_run_...).

Response

تم قبول إعادة تشغيل مسار العمل ويتم تشغيله بشكل غير متزامن.

message
string
Example:

"تم بدء إعادة تشغيل مسار العمل بنجاح."

new_run
object